Swamp Sailing
We left Barefoot Marina with water under our keel (TYG) around 08:30 am. It was cool most of the day with light breezes and sunshine. We motored past some beautiful homes, golf courses, and scenic areas. A large part of our trip was through the "swamp river" (not its real name but what Ken and Greg called it as they radio'd each other - Ken was looking for people playing banjo's) - Cypress Swamp (real name). It was a long day of motoring toward our destination of Georgetown (South Carolina). We were about an hour away from Georgetown when the sun was getting low and so was the tide, therefore we though it best to anchor where we were on the Waccamaw River. We motored just outside the channel, anchored, and admired a beautiful sunset.
